Nurses’ Bargaining Association (NBA) Collective Agreement

This collective agreement covers registered nurses and licensed practical nurses in acute care, long-term care and community care.

The 2022-2025 (NBA) contract is effective April 1, 2022 – March 31, 2025 and can be found here.
